Pete Finocchio

Hello Miami. My name is Pete and I have returned to Miami from the salty shores of Massachusetts. I worked here at WVUM from 2005-2009 when I was an undergraduate at UM, hosting a delicious little slice of evening drive time on Thursdays. Well, apparently that wasn’t enough so I’m back for grad school and most importantly, more WVUM. Tune in for two hours of ///Pete’s Beats/// every Thursday afternoon from 5-7pm!

SpinnZinn

SpinnZinn is WVUM’s very own techno and house expert. Having been behind the decks for 9+ years, he is a mastermind at mixing and manipulating music.
SpinnZinn is well known in places such as Frankfurt, Germany and is a staple part of Miami’s underground scene. His style and energy are unmatched!
Tune in every Thursday from 9pm-12am to experience the SpinnZinn phenomenon, along side weekly guests!
